Explosives Museum and LibraryThe SEE Education Foundation is a non-profit educational foundation serving the explosives industry and the general public. The Foundation through its museum activities, houses a significant collection of artifacts, archival books, files, technical reports, maps, brochures, and documents. This is in addition to its reference library, headquartered in Cleveland, OH, containing one of the largest collections in the world of technical and non-technical literature, publications, videos, audio tapes, reports, case studies and more relating to the manufacture, transportation, storage, use and disposal of commercial explosives. The Foundation undertakes research, education, training and documentation. It also develops and funds seminars, media, educational materials, and programs directly, and in partnership with other industry organizations. For example, since its inception, the Society has sponsored and co-sponsored the production of the educational videos such as Explosives: The Power Tool, How Commercial Explosives Help To Shape Our Lives, co-sponsored with the Institute of Makers of Explosives and Nobel Insurance, intended to educate the public about how the use of commercial explosives improves the quality of life in our world today. And Understanding Vibrations from Blasting, developed by the Society's Public Education Committee as a video and DVD, and produced by the Foundation to compliment the Power Tools video and work to educate homeowners and others about the effects of blasting in their neighborhood. The World of Explosives website is another ongoing project designed to work hand-in-hand with the museum and library. It is being developed to demonstrate the spirit, heritage, interest, and value of commercial explosives nationally and internationally. Designed for the public, the site focuses on history, uses, projects, links, reference tools and more relating the commercial explosives industry. Guides and links to other sources of information will aid researchers and students and provide a quick reference tool. |
